Abstract
Monitoring stress levels has turn out to be a critical part of healthcare structures for physical and mental illnesses. Continuous stress tracking might help users better understand their stress patterns and offer physicians with greater dependable information for interventions. However, current stress tracking structures have did not acquire private information in an ordinary context. The contemporary country of sensor era permits us to broaden structures measuring the physiological signals, which replicate stress with the aid of using wearable devices. Therefore, we advise a stress tracking device that offers a goal each day healthcare primarily based totally on private physiological signals: electrocardiogram (ECG), photo plethysmogram (PPG), and galvanic skin response (GSR). We use the wearable devices, Shimmer3 ECG, Shimmer3 GSR and Empatica E4 Wristband, to monitor stress ubiquitously. We carry out managed stress experiments on sixteen members and the device effectively detects stress with 92.55% accuracy for 10-fold cross-validation and 83.61% accuracy for subject-wise cross-validation. In everyday settings, the device assesses stress with 82.12% accuracy. We also examine whether movement artifacts have an affect on stress assessment.
